The Historic Blue Moon Hotel - Nyc: A restored 1879 tenement with Lower East Side charm and modern amenities
The Historic Blue Moon Hotel - Nyc occupies a meticulously restored 1879 tenement building in Manhattan's Lower East Side, blending historic details with contemporary comforts. The 22 individually furnished rooms feature air conditioning, flat-screen TVs with streaming services, kitchenettes, and free WiFi, while some offer city or quiet street views. Guests can enjoy a continental breakfast at the on-site Sweet Dreams Cafe and Bakery, which serves Italian specialties like the Biscotti Di Tutti Biscotti and Tuscan cheesecake. The hotel provides 24-hour reception and check-in, multilingual staff, and complimentary access to a nearby fitness facility. Located less than three blocks from Delancey and Essex Street subway stations, The Historic Blue Moon Hotel is within walking distance of Katz's Delicatessen, the Tenement Museum, and SoHo shopping. Broadway theaters and the Empire State Building are accessible via a 25-minute subway ride.
